Tenanted properties: If you’re an Awliscombe landlord wanting to exit the rental market, selling a tenanted property through traditional channels can be challenging and slow. Property auctions excel with tenanted properties—competitive bidding often achieves strong prices, and the fixed completion date removes uncertainty. Cash buyers also purchase tenanted properties, though you’ll typically receive a lower price reflecting their ongoing rental income.
